On Jan 26, I woke up to temps in the upper 60's to nearly 70 degrees.Was this a trick from Mother Nature? Who cares? And to top it off, the rest of this week the weather is going to be perfect with temps in the 70's.
Looks like it's time to wipe the dust off of your tackle and hit the water, if you haven't already been out.
Typically, it's a little cooler this time of year, but maybe Mother Nature forgot to buy a new calendar for 2013, and that's fine by me.

If you missed my last report, I've been fishing in Blackwater and Escambia for trout and reds. We caught some reds but more trout. I've found the bite to be really good in the afternoon from 11-5 p.m.. Back at it again all this week both fun fishing and charters.
